THIS TASK ORDER IS AWARDED TO CYBER ENGINEERING AND TECHNICAL ALLIANCE, LLC (CETA) TO OBTAIN PLANNING, EXERCISE, READINESS & TRAINING (PERT) SUPPORT FOR THE DEPARTMENT OF HOMELAND SECURITY (DHS) CYBERSECURITY AND INFRASTRUCTURE SECURITY AGENCY (C is a federal SBA award for Cisa Acq Div held by Cyber Engineering and Technical Alliance, LLC. Estimated value $13M ($8.7M obligated). Current period of performance ends Dec 14, 2025. Last award drew 6 bidders. Place of performance: COLUMBIA MD. Related solicitation 70RCSA21Q00000123.
